Balua Ghatti Population - Katihar, Bihar

Balua Ghatti is a medium size village located in Amdabad Block of Katihar district, Bihar with total 360 families residing. The Balua Ghatti village has population of 1614 of which 837 are males while 777 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Balua Ghatti village population of children with age 0-6 is 246 which makes up 15.24 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Balua Ghatti village is 928 which is higher than Bihar state average of 918. Child Sex Ratio for the Balua Ghatti as per census is 892, lower than Bihar average of 935.

Balua Ghatti village has higher literacy rate compared to Bihar. In 2011, literacy rate of Balua Ghatti village was 64.62 % compared to 61.80 % of Bihar. In Balua Ghatti Male literacy stands at 70.16 % while female literacy rate was 58.70 %.

Balua Ghatti Data

Particulars Total Male Female
Total No. of Houses 360 - -
Population 1,614 837 777
Child (0-6) 246 130 116
Schedule Caste 278 147 131
Schedule Tribe 173 86 87
Literacy 64.62 % 70.16 % 58.70 %
Total Workers 618 454 164
Main Worker 319 - -
Marginal Worker 299 193 106

Caste Factor

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 17.22 % while Schedule Tribe (ST) were 10.72 % of total population in Balua Ghatti village.

Work Profile

In Balua Ghatti village out of total population, 618 were engaged in work activities. 51.62 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 48.38 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 618 workers engaged in Main Work, 147 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 104 were Agricultural labourer.
